"A Bit Patchy" is a single by English DJ Switch. It is based on the 1973 recording of "Apache", by Incredible Bongo Band. It was first released at the end of 2005 in discos and dance clubs, before arriving to the charts in 2006. The song was then remixed by various artists, including Eric Prydz, Sinden and Sub Focus.
Pitchy Patchy is a costume character in Jamaican Jankunu festival figure. Other characters include: King and Queen, Cow Head, Horse Head, red Indians and Belly Woman. [1]One of the original figures of Jamaican Jankunu character, Pitchy Patchy is usually represented by a suit made of tattered, colorful pieces of cloth.
Marco is a 2024 Indian Malayalam-language neo-noir action thriller film written and directed by Haneef Adeni and produced by Shareef Muhammed under Cubes Entertainments. The film stars Unni Mukundan in the titular role, alongside Siddique, Jagadish, Abhimanyu Shammi Thilakan, Kabir Duhan Singh, Anson Paul and Yukti Thareja in supporting roles.
Lifeline is an American science fiction drama series distributed on YouTube Red [1] which began October 11, 2017. [2] It starred Zach Gilford and Sydney Park.Created by screenwriters Benjamin Freiburger and Grant Wheeler, the show tells the tale of an insurance agency that uses time travel to prevent the deaths of their clients.
